KHARA WAGNER

Partner and Chief Executive Officer
Anomaly 

 


BIO

Khara Wagner is Partner and CEO of Anomaly in Los Angeles, with more than 20 years of experience helping build and grow iconic brands. 

She began her career at BBH, where she found a way out of law school, a path to New York and a passion for the industry. Since then, she has worked across nearly every category, partnering with iconic global brands like McDonald’s, Starbucks, and Visa, and leading portfolios for global companies including Unilever, P&G, and General Mills. Along the way, she’s held roles at agencies such as Grey, Saatchi & Saatchi, and TBWA. 

A strategic problem solver at heart, Khara is driven by solutions that are smart, simple, and surprising. She’s a strong advocate for people and culture, leading with the belief that if you work for her, she works for you. She’s deeply curious and a lifelong learner —constantly exploring new technologies, tools, and ways of working. 

Now in her fourth year as CEO, Khara is leading Anomaly Los Angeles through its next phase of growth. Nearly a decade after the office was founded, the focus has been on scaling the business through investment in diverse talent, expanded capabilities, and a clear emphasis on creativity that delivers business impact.
